news 2026/4/16 12:15:08

Obsidian代码美化神器:Better CodeBlock插件终极使用指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Obsidian代码美化神器:Better CodeBlock插件终极使用指南

Obsidian代码美化神器:Better CodeBlock插件终极使用指南

【免费下载链接】obsidian-better-codeblockAdd title, line number to Obsidian code block项目地址: https://gitcode.com/gh_mirrors/ob/obsidian-better-codeblock

还在为Obsidian中单调的代码块而烦恼吗?Better CodeBlock插件正是你需要的代码美化利器!这款专为Obsidian设计的插件通过添加标题、行号和高亮功能,让你的技术笔记瞬间升级为专业级文档。无论是日常编码记录、技术文档撰写还是知识管理,Better CodeBlock都能让代码展示更加清晰直观。

🎯 核心功能:三大美化特性详解

Better CodeBlock插件通过三个核心功能模块,彻底改变你的代码展示体验:

智能标题系统

告别无标识的代码块!使用TI:"你的标题"语法为每个代码块添加专属名称,让读者一眼就能了解代码用途。标题不仅美观,更具备功能性——点击即可折叠或展开代码内容。

精准行号定位

插件自动为代码块添加行号显示,便于代码讨论和问题定位。无论是单行调试还是多行分析,行号功能都能极大提升代码阅读效率。

重点高亮标记

使用HL:"行数"语法标记关键代码行,支持多种高亮模式:

  • 单行高亮:HL:"5"
  • 多行高亮:HL:"1,3,5"
  • 范围高亮:HL:"1-3"

Better CodeBlock插件在Java代码块中的美化效果,包含标题、行号和高亮功能

📋 实用语法速查表

功能类型语法格式使用示例效果说明
添加标题TI:"标题内容"TI:"数据处理函数"在代码块顶部显示自定义标题
代码高亮HL:"行数"HL:"2,4-6"标记指定行为重点内容
默认折叠"FOLD"单独使用设置代码块初始状态为折叠

🚀 快速上手:四步安装指南

第一步:获取插件文件

从项目仓库下载三个核心文件:main.jsstyles.cssmanifest.json。这些文件包含了插件的全部功能实现。

第二步:创建插件目录

在你的Obsidian库中建立专用文件夹:VaultFolder/.obsidian/plugins/obsidian-better-codeblock/

第三步:复制文件

将下载的三个文件复制到新建的插件目录中。

第四步:启用插件

重启Obsidian应用,在设置菜单的插件选项中找到并启用"Better CodeBlock"。

💡 实战应用场景

技术文档编写

为API接口示例代码添加清晰的标题和关键行标记,让文档读者快速理解代码逻辑。

代码教学笔记

在编程教学笔记中使用行号和高亮功能,便于讲解特定代码段的实现原理。

项目文档管理

为不同模块的代码块设置专属标题,建立清晰的项目代码索引系统。

Better CodeBlock显示语言标识功能,右上角清晰标注代码类型

⚡ 高级技巧与最佳实践

语法组合使用

将多个功能语法组合使用,实现更丰富的展示效果。例如同时设置标题、高亮和折叠状态,让代码块既美观又实用。

多语言支持

插件支持多种编程语言的语法高亮,包括Java、Kotlin、Python等常见语言,确保每种语言的代码都能获得最佳展示效果。

🔧 常见问题解决方案

自动换行异常

偶尔出现的自动换行问题可以通过切换预览模式轻松解决,这是一个已知的小问题。

PDF导出注意事项

目前PDF导出功能暂不支持自动换行,建议在导出前调整代码块宽度以确保格式正确。

📈 版本演进与功能增强

从最初的1.0.1版本到当前的1.0.8版本,Better CodeBlock插件持续优化用户体验:

  • 1.0.4版本:新增右上角语言标识功能
  • 1.0.5版本:实现语法组合功能,支持同时设置多个参数
  • 持续改进:修复已知问题,提升插件稳定性

Better CodeBlock代码块折叠功能,让复杂代码管理更加轻松

🎉 结语:让代码展示更专业

Obsidian Better CodeBlock插件通过简单直观的操作方式,为你的代码块添加专业级美化效果。无论是个人笔记还是团队文档,都能通过这款插件提升代码展示的专业性和可读性。立即尝试,体验不一样的代码展示效果!

如果你在使用过程中有任何建议或发现了更好的使用方法,欢迎参与项目讨论,共同完善这款优秀的Obsidian插件。

【免费下载链接】obsidian-better-codeblockAdd title, line number to Obsidian code block项目地址: https://gitcode.com/gh_mirrors/ob/obsidian-better-codeblock

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/11 23:26:08

Defender Control:终极Windows Defender禁用工具完整指南

Defender Control:终极Windows Defender禁用工具完整指南 【免费下载链接】defender-control An open-source windows defender manager. Now you can disable windows defender permanently. 项目地址: https://gitcode.com/gh_mirrors/de/defender-control …

作者头像 李华
网站建设 2026/4/12 21:31:51

3个必学的智能家居位置感知自动化场景:从入门到精通

想要让智能家居真正理解你的位置并自动响应吗?智能家居位置感知技术正成为现代家庭自动化的核心能力。通过精准的位置检测,你的家可以在你到达时自动开灯、调节温度,离开时关闭不必要的电器,实现真正的智能化生活体验。本文将带你…

作者头像 李华
网站建设 2026/4/16 11:18:41

16、利用GCC在线帮助:GNU Info使用指南

利用GCC在线帮助:GNU Info使用指南 1. GNU Info简介 GNU Info是由自由软件基金会(FSF)采用的非标准在线帮助格式,用于记录其软件信息。它是一个超文本在线帮助系统,旨在取代传统的Unix手册页。与Unix手册页相比,GNU Info功能更强大、更灵活,能使用目录、交叉引用和索引…

作者头像 李华
网站建设 2026/4/15 4:52:35

3步轻松搞定BetterNCM安装:网易云音乐终极增强指南

3步轻松搞定BetterNCM安装:网易云音乐终极增强指南 【免费下载链接】BetterNCM-Installer 一键安装 Better 系软件 项目地址: https://gitcode.com/gh_mirrors/be/BetterNCM-Installer 想要让你的网易云音乐播放器拥有更多实用功能吗?BetterNCM安…

作者头像 李华
网站建设 2026/4/14 6:47:19

PvZWidescreen:植物大战僵尸宽屏适配终极指南

PvZWidescreen:植物大战僵尸宽屏适配终极指南 【免费下载链接】PvZWidescreen Widescreen mod for Plants vs Zombies 项目地址: https://gitcode.com/gh_mirrors/pv/PvZWidescreen PvZWidescreen模组通过智能代码注入技术,为经典游戏《植物大战僵…

作者头像 李华
网站建设 2026/4/4 1:54:53

OpenPLC Editor:开源工业自动化编程的革命性工具

工业自动化领域正在经历一场开源革命,而OpenPLC Editor正是这场变革中的关键角色。这款基于Beremiz项目的多平台PLC编程工具,为工程师和开发者提供了全新的工业控制系统开发体验。 【免费下载链接】OpenPLC_Editor 项目地址: https://gitcode.com/gh_…

作者头像 李华